Role of Artificial Intelligence in Web Development
Discover how Artificial Intelligence is revolutionizing web development by enhancing user experience, automating design, improving security, and boosting website performance.
In the rapidly evolving digital landscape, web development is no longer limited to coding and design. The integration of Artificial Intelligence (AI) is reshaping how websites are conceptualized, developed, and maintained. AI technologies, including machine learning, natural language processing, and computer vision, are creating smarter, faster, and more personalized web experiences. This blog explores the pivotal role of AI in web development, highlighting its benefits, applications, and future potential.
AI-Powered Website Design and Development
Traditionally, web development required manual coding, rigorous design testing, and iterative changes to meet user expectations. AI has streamlined this process significantly. AI-powered platforms, such as Wix ADI and Bookmark, use algorithms to analyze user preferences and automatically generate website layouts. These tools reduce development time, minimize errors, and ensure aesthetically appealing designs.
AI also assists developers by suggesting code snippets, detecting bugs, and optimizing web structures. For instance, tools like GitHub Copilot leverage AI to offer real-time code suggestions, enabling developers to write cleaner and more efficient code. This reduces manual workload and accelerates project completion.
Enhancing User Experience with Personalization
User experience (UX) is a critical factor in retaining website visitors and driving engagement. AI enables hyper-personalization by analyzing user behavior, preferences, and browsing history. AI algorithms can dynamically adjust content, recommend products, or modify website layouts based on individual user patterns.
For e-commerce websites, AI-driven personalization can suggest relevant products, predict shopping behavior, and optimize checkout processes. Similarly, content-heavy platforms can deliver tailored content recommendations, enhancing user satisfaction and increasing engagement metrics.
AI Chatbots and Virtual Assistants
One of the most visible applications of AI in web development is chatbots. AI chatbots provide real-time customer support, answer queries, and guide users through website navigation. Unlike traditional scripted bots, AI chatbots utilize natural language processing (NLP) to understand complex questions and deliver human-like responses.
Virtual assistants powered by AI, such as Google Assistant or custom website bots, improve user interaction, reduce response time, and ensure 24/7 availability. This not only enhances user experience but also frees human resources for more strategic tasks.
Automation in Web Maintenance
Maintaining a website involves regular updates, bug fixes, and performance optimization. AI tools can automate many of these tasks, ensuring websites remain secure and efficient. AI algorithms can monitor website performance, detect anomalies, and automatically implement fixes or alert developers.
Predictive analytics, powered by AI, can forecast potential downtime or technical issues, enabling proactive maintenance. This minimizes disruptions, enhances reliability, and reduces operational costs for businesses.
Optimizing SEO and Content Strategy
Search Engine Optimization (SEO) is vital for online visibility. AI has transformed traditional SEO Services
strategies by providing data-driven insights and automation. AI tools analyze search trends, user intent, and competitor strategies to suggest optimized keywords and content improvements.
Content creation and optimization are also enhanced by AI. Platforms can generate meta tags, headlines, or even full content drafts, ensuring alignment with SEO best practices. This allows businesses to maintain an active online presence while saving time and resources.
Improved Website Security
Cybersecurity is a growing concern for web developers and website owners. AI enhances security by detecting potential threats, identifying unusual patterns, and preventing cyber attacks. Machine learning algorithms can analyze large volumes of data to detect vulnerabilities and unauthorized access attempts.
AI-powered security tools, such as automated firewalls and threat detection systems, provide real-time protection against malware, phishing, and other online threats. This proactive approach minimizes risks and strengthens user trust in digital platforms.
AI in Performance Monitoring and Analytics
Understanding how users interact with a website is crucial for improvement and growth. AI-driven analytics tools provide deeper insights into user behavior, engagement patterns, and conversion metrics. Unlike traditional analytics, AI can process complex datasets and identify trends that may not be immediately visible.
By leveraging AI for performance monitoring, developers can make data-driven decisions to enhance website speed, improve navigation, and optimize overall functionality. This results in a seamless user experience and higher retention rates.
Voice and Visual Search Integration
With the rise of voice assistants and smart devices, voice search is becoming increasingly important. AI enables websites to incorporate voice search capabilities, making navigation more intuitive and accessible. Users can find information, products, or services quickly without typing, enhancing convenience and engagement.
Similarly, visual search powered by AI allows users to search for products using images. This is particularly beneficial for e-commerce platforms, enabling users to find exact or similar products with a simple photo upload. Integrating these AI features enhances interactivity and user satisfaction.
Future Potential of AI in Web Development
The future of AI in web development is promising. Emerging technologies like generative AI, augmented reality (AR), and machine learning will further transform digital experiences. Websites will become more adaptive, predictive, and capable of delivering immersive experiences.
Developers will increasingly rely on AI to automate repetitive tasks, enhance design creativity, and create more intelligent interfaces. Businesses that embrace AI in their web strategies will gain a competitive edge, offering superior user experiences and operational efficiency.
Conclusion
Artificial Intelligence is no longer a futuristic concept; it is an integral part of modern web development. From automating design processes to enhancing user experience, AI is transforming how websites are built, maintained, and optimized. Its applications in personalization, chatbots, SEO, security, and analytics are reshaping digital landscapes and setting new standards for innovation.
For businesses and developers, leveraging AI in web development is not just about staying competitive—it’s about creating smarter, faster, and more engaging web experiences that meet the demands of today’s tech-savvy users. As AI technology continues to evolve, its role in web development will only grow, paving the way for a more intelligent and interconnected digital world.